Q: Is 47,768,887 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 47,768,887 is a composite number.

Why is 47,768,887 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 47,768,887 can be evenly divided by 1 29 37 1,073 44,519 1,291,051 1,647,203 and 47,768,887, with no remainder.

Since 47,768,887 cannot be divided by just 1 and 47,768,887, it is a composite number.
